Portrait of Pete Reiser, outfielder for the Boston Braves. Bowman series. Printed on back: "Harold 'Pete' Reiser. Outfield, Boston Braves. Born: St. Louis, March 17, 1920. Height: 5-10 1/2. Weight: 180. Bats: both. Throws: right. 'Pete' hit .274 in 184 games in 1949. His first full season in the majors was 1941. That year he was the National League's leading batsman. His average was .343. He led the senior circuit in total runs scored, total bases and triples. Has been on 2 all-star teams, and in 2 World's Series. Traded to the Boston Braves in the fall of 1948. No. 193 in the series of baseball picture cards. [Copyright] 1950 Bowman Gum, Inc., Phila., Pa., U.S.A. Picture Card Collectors Club, 5-star Bowman series."
